Property Description
Set on nearly 6 acres across two parcels, this Territorial home offers rare privacy, 360° views, and flexible living. The great room rises with tall beamed ceilings, enhanced by accent lighting that adds depth and warmth, while the updated KitchenAid kitchen anchors the heart of the home. The 3,095 sq ft main house includes a den with its own wood-burning fireplace and a north-facing office filled with natural light. The home offers 3 large bedrooms and an attached 1-bedroom casita with its own entrance, ideal for guests or multigenerational living. Outside, a south-facing pool, ramada, and natural desert landscaping frame sunrise, sunset, city, and sweeping mountain views. The adjacent, buildable 1-acre parcel offers future potential or a lasting privacy buffer
